What is your birth card in Tarot?

Your birth card (also known as your "life path" card) is the Major Arcana card that corresponds to the number you get by adding all of the numbers in your birthday. You can also see how you embody - or could embody - the qualities of the Major Arcana card in a positive way to find your soul's purpose.

What does death mean in Tarot cards?

Death (XIII) is the 13th trump or Major Arcana card in most traditional Tarot decks. It is used in Tarot card games as well as in divination. The card typically depicts the Grim Reaper, and when used for divination is often interpreted as signifying major changes in a person's life.
